The majority of robot vacuums and mops can be customised using an app that can save your home's maps, set cleaning schedules and select mopping modes. You can also alter the suction power and fine-tune how much water and scrub action your mop makes use of.
A mapping feature helps your robot navigate through rooms and obstacles, while an obstacle avoidance feature prevents it from running into wires, furniture or other pet toys. These features are vital in my home filled with toys.
1. Roborock S8 Pro Ultra
Roborock S8 Pro Ultra, the top-of-the-line vacuum and mop, is packed with features. It can mop and sweep simultaneously, and raise its brushes or mop pads to ensure that soft surfaces don't get too wet. It can also see and avoid obstacles, with the ability to spot pet toys plants, a variety of small objects.
The robot vacuum's maximum suction power is 6,000 pascals. This is more than any other robot vacuum we've examined to date. It also has PreciSense LiDAR navigation, which tracks its position, which helps prevent it from getting stuck on objects.
The mopping function is impressive, with the S8 Pro Ultra able to apply constant pressure of over 6 Newtons to the mop pad to provide an intense clean. It also has mop lifter which lifts the pad automatically as it changes between tile and laminate hardwood, carpet or rugs, in order to prevent soaking soft surfaces.
The S8 Pro Ultra also has self-washing and self drying features. The pad can be rinsing and heat-drying within the dock. The dust bin will automatically empty before returning to the dock. This means that you can set it and forget it, only having to change the dust bag or refill the water tank every now and then.
All of this is powered by a lithium-ion battery of 5,200mAh. I tested it with its standard vac and mop settings for about 160 minutes before the S8 Pro Ultra started to get power hungry and return to its base for a recharge. This isn't far off from the 180 minutes that Roborock claims and is at par other hybrids I've tested.
It's a well-rounded and capable product, with the only drawback being that it's pricey. But its abundance of features makes it a appealing alternative for anyone who wishes to ditch their old stick vacuum and mops. If you can afford the cost we recommend you check this one out.

4. Roborock Qrevo
The Qrevo is Roborock's cheapest mop and automatic vacuum and mop robot, but it has some outstanding features. The dock's multi-function function is emptying the robot's dirtbag and refilling its water tanks, and washing and sanitizing mop pads is handled by the dock. The mopping system itself is capable of cleaning a good bit of a space before returning to its dock and the vacuum's high suction does a nice job of removing dirt and pet hair on carpets.
The software that runs this appliance is dense, offering a wide variety of options to personalize the cleaning process. You can choose to manually clean every area that is that this device maps or select individual rooms, an expandable zone or a routine you've developed. There are several mopping options, including SmartPlan -an algorithm that makes use of the sensors of the mops to determine the most efficient way to clean your home as it maps the area.
The Qrevo performed well in our tests, like all the Roborock models that we've tested. Its navigation system is reliable, mapping rooms quickly and cleaning them in an organized way. The 'Normal" pathing setting covers the room thoroughly, without any major gaps or missed areas. The Reactive Tech hazard avoidance system works fairly well, too, though it's not as advanced as the color camera system on the Qrevo Master or the S8 Pro Ultra. It can detect dangers such as thick carpets but might not be able to recognize smaller items such as rug tassels and electrical wires.
The most obvious flaw with this device is the absence of a mop-after-vacuum option, which could be a problem for those who spend a lot of time vacuuming before cleaning their robot. Thankfully, there's an easy solution: the app offers an option to "clean up" at the end of each vacuuming session. This lets you use the mopping function of the vacuum to get rid of the last traces of debris and dust that you've left behind from your vacuuming. This is a nice feature that lets this vacuum keep its cleanness a bit higher than its less expensive competitors.
